Worthington Kilbourne was not able to break out of their rough patch on Monday as the team picked up their third straight defeat. They lost 9-2 to the Big Walnut Golden Eagles.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Golden Eagles this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 14-3 last Wednesday.
Worthington Kilbourne saw three different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Braden Pullins, who went 2-for-3 with two stolen bases and one run.
Worthington Kilbourne's loss dropped their record down to 9-5. As for Big Walnut, they are on a roll lately: they've won six of their last seven games. That's provided a nice bump to their 8-3 record this season.
Worthington Kilbourne is taking a road trip to square off against Olentangy at 5:00 p.m. on Thursday. As for Big Walnut, they will welcome Westerville North at 5:00 p.m. on Wednesday. The Golden Eagles' pitchers better be ready for this one: the Warriors have averaged an impressive 6.9 runs per game this season.
